Marvel Studios has unleashed the first full trailer for Avengers: Doomsday, and it’s everything fans could have hoped for — and more. Directed by Joe and Anthony Russo, the powerhouse siblings returning to the MCU after their record-breaking work on Avengers: Infinity War and Endgame, the film promises to unite heroes from across multiple universes in a massive multiverse-spanning showdown against the formidable Doctor Doom.

The trailer, released on July 20, 2026, opens with sweeping shots of chaos erupting across realities before diving into a star-studded assembly of heroes. Robert Downey Jr. makes a commanding presence as Victor von Doom, portrayed with the menacing intellect and iron will that comic fans have long anticipated. The Russo Brothers have assembled what looks like the largest crossover in MCU history, pulling in characters from the Avengers, Fantastic Four, X-Men, Wakandans, and beyond.

What the Trailer Reveals

The footage teases an existential threat unlike anything the MCU has faced. Heroes from different universes are thrust into a deadly collision course as Doctor Doom’s ambitions threaten the fabric of reality itself. Standout moments include:

  • Chris Evans returning as Steve Rogers/Captain America
  • Chris Hemsworth’s Thor rallying the troops
  • Pedro Pascal as Reed Richards/Mister Fantastic leading the Fantastic Four
  • Iconic X-Men stars like Patrick Stewart (Professor X), Ian McKellen (Magneto), and more
  • Core MCU players including Anthony Mackie’s Captain America, Florence Pugh’s Yelena Belova, Paul Rudd’s Ant-Man, Letitia Wright’s Shuri, and many others

The trailer is packed with jaw-dropping visuals, multiverse-hopping action, and the signature Russo brothers’ blend of large-scale spectacle and character-driven drama. Fans are already dissecting every frame for clues about the plot, potential surprises, and how this colossal team-up will unfold.

A Historic MCU Milestone

Avengers: Doomsday marks a major culmination of the Multiverse Saga. With a release date of December 18, 2026, the film is positioned as one of the biggest cinematic events of the year. Produced by Kevin Feige and the Marvel Studios team, it sets the stage for Avengers: Secret Wars the following year.

The Russo Brothers’ return has generated huge excitement. Their ability to balance humor, heart, and high-stakes action made Infinity War and Endgame cultural phenomena, and early reactions suggest Doomsday could reach similar heights.
